identification

Nouns

  • (n) the act of designating or identifying something designation,
  • (n) evidence of identity; something that identifies a person or thing
  • (n) the condition of having the identity (of a person or object) established
    • the thief's identification was followed quickly by his arrest
    • identification of the gun was an important clue
  • (n) the process of recognizing something or someone by remembering
    • a politician whose recall of names was as remarkable as his recognition of faces
    • experimental psychologists measure the elapsed time from the onset of the stimulus to its recognition by the observer
    recognition,
  • (n) the attribution to yourself (consciously or unconsciously) of the characteristics of another person (or group of persons)
